P code powertrain High severity

P00BA Low Fuel Pressure Forced Limited Power

The OBD2 code P00BA indicates that the engine control module has detected low fuel pressure, which has triggered a limitation on engine power to prevent damage or poor performance

Definition

The OBD2 code P00BA indicates that the engine control module has detected low fuel pressure, which has triggered a limitation on engine power to prevent damage or poor performance

Common causes

  • Fuel pump failure
  • Clogged fuel filter
  • Low fuel level
  • Fuel pressure regulator malfunction
  • Fuel line leaks or blockages
  • Faulty fuel injectors
  • Electrical issues (wiring or connectors)
  • Engine control module (ECM) issues
  • Vacuum leaks in the fuel system
  • Contaminated fuel

Common misdiagnoses

  • Fuel pump failure
  • Fuel filter blockage
  • Fuel pressure regulator issues
  • Clogged fuel injectors
  • Faulty fuel pressure sensor
  • Electrical issues in the fuel system
  • Vacuum leaks
  • Engine control module (ECM) problems
  • Air intake issues
  • Throttle body problems

Troubleshooting steps

  1. 1. Check Fuel Level

    Ensure that the fuel tank has an adequate amount of fuel. Sometimes, low fuel levels can trigger this code

  2. 2. Inspect Fuel Pump

    Fuel Pump Operation: Listen for the fuel pump when the ignition is turned on. It should make a humming sound for a few seconds

  3. 3. Fuel Pressure Test

    Use a fuel pressure gauge to check the fuel pressure at the fuel rail. Compare the reading to the manufacturer's specifications

  4. 4. Examine Fuel Filter

    A clogged fuel filter can restrict fuel flow. Inspect and replace the fuel filter if necessary

  5. 5. Check Fuel Lines

    Inspect the fuel lines for any leaks, kinks, or blockages that could impede fuel flow

  6. 6. Inspect Fuel Injectors

    Ensure that the fuel injectors are functioning properly. Check for clogs or electrical issues that may prevent them from opening

  7. 7. Examine Fuel Pressure Regulator

    Check the fuel pressure regulator for proper operation. A malfunctioning regulator can cause low fuel pressure

  8. 8. Check for Vacuum Leaks

    Inspect the intake system for any vacuum leaks that could affect fuel pressure and engine performance

  9. 9. Scan for Additional Codes

    Use an OBD-II scanner to check for any other related trouble codes that may provide more context to the issue

  10. 10. Inspect Electrical Connections

    Check the wiring and connectors related to the fuel pump, fuel pressure sensor, and fuel injectors for any signs of damage or corrosion

  11. 11. Test Fuel Pressure Sensor

    If equipped, test the fuel pressure sensor for proper operation. A faulty sensor can give incorrect readings and trigger the code.1

  12. 12. Check Engine Control Module (ECM)

    In rare cases, the ECM may have a fault. Ensure that the software is up to date and that there are no issues with the module.1

  13. 13. Clear Codes and Test Drive

    After addressing any issues, clear the trouble codes and take the vehicle for a test drive to see if the code returns.1

  14. 14. Consult Repair Manual

    Refer to the vehicle's service manual for specific diagnostic procedures and specifications related to the fuel system.1

  15. 15. Seek Professional Help

    If the issue persists after performing these steps, it may be best to consult a professional mechanic for further diagnosis. By following these troubleshooting steps, you can systematically identify and resolve the underlying issues causing the P00BA code